Workers’ Rights [page 13]

“Ireland is strongly committed to the protection and promotion of both domestic and migrant workers’ rights through national and international legislation, with a robust body of employment rights legislation which provides employees with a means for redress in cases where their employment rights have been breached. In 2017, Ireland has taken up, for the first time, a Titulaire seat on the Governing Body of the International Labour Organisation (ILO). During its term, Ireland will maintain and promote its commitment to human rights and will work to enhance the profile of business and human rights in the framework of the ILO.”
